The past four years have been the winningest era in the two-decade plus history of Hamline women's soccer. One of the main reasons for that has been the play of senior forward Aileen Scheibner. Aileen will make her final Paterson Field appearance Wednesday when the Pipers host St. Mary's at 3:30 p.m.

Unfortunately, injuries have dogged her the past two seasons. But that hasn't stopped her from being one of the top offensive forces in the league. She will leave HU ranked second all-time in Goals (26), Assists (17), Points (69) and Game-Winning Goals (7). Her four gamewinners in 2011 is a single season record. 

An excellent student, she is a nominee for the Capital One CoSIDA Academic All-American team this year. 

In addition to the game with the Cardinals, HU finishes the season November 1 at Gustavus.
